## Name truncate ## Synopsis ```sh $ truncate [--size size] [--reference file] <file> ``` ## Options - `-s size`, `--size size`: Resize the target file to (or by) this size. Prefix with + or - to expand or shrink the file, or a bare number to set the size exactly - `-r file`, `--reference file`: Resize the target file to match the size of this one ## Arguments - `file`: File path <!-- Auto-generated through ArgsParser -->
